Purpose of Position:
To provide quality customer service and to collect non-blood and blood specimens for medical pathology analysis, within the legal-ethical framework of the nursing profession in a phlebotomy environment.
Requirements:
Relevant HPCSA/SANC registration (Required), Relevant Phlebotomy or Nursing qualification (Required)
Required Experience:
Experience as a Phlebotomist or similar position within a pathology or hospital environment.
Key Responsibilities:
Maintain good client relations and promote the image of Ampath., Manage the money/cash flow of the Care Centre to facilitate the collection of payments for phlebotomy services rendered., Perform administrative tasks to ensure correct recording and processing of information., Perform phlebotomy procedures to ensure sufficient delivery of the Care Centre services., Perform safety and quality control tasks to ensure that relevant standards are upheld.
